The duration of air travel between Phoenix, Arizona, and Anaheim, California, is a key factor for travelers planning trips between these two destinations. This duration is influenced by several elements, including the chosen airline, specific route, and prevailing weather conditions. Direct flights generally offer the shortest travel time, while connecting flights typically involve longer durations due to layovers and transfers. For instance, a non-stop route might take approximately one hour and fifteen minutes, while a flight with a connection could extend the journey to several hours.
